Yes, Spanish citizens need a visa to enter Egypt. You can obtain the tourist visa in two main ways: applying online (e-Visa) before traveling, or purchasing it upon arrival at the Egyptian airport. The visa on arrival is a stamp purchased at bank counters before passport control. Make sure your passport is valid for at least six months from the date of entry into the country.
Currently, most direct flights from Spain (such as cheap Madrid to Egypt flights or affordable Barcelona to Egypt flights) usually land at Cairo International Airport (CAI). During the peak winter season, some charter or low-cost airlines may offer direct flights to Red Sea tourist destinations like Hurghada (HRG) or Sharm el Sheikh (SSH). For other destinations like Luxor or Aswan, you will almost always need flights to Egypt with a cheap layover.

When booking flights to Egypt with a cheap layover, check the duration of the layover. A very short layover (less than 90 minutes) can be risky if there are delays. A very long layover can be exhausting. If the layover is in Europe, make sure you don't need to change airports. Always verify that the airline is responsible for transferring your luggage. Layovers in cities like Rome, Istanbul, or Athens are common for reaching cheap flights to Cairo or Alexandria.
Essential Practical Guide for Traveling to Egypt from Spain
Planning your trip to Egypt requires knowing practical details about visas, local transportation, and customs. This guide offers vital information to make your experience comfortable and without surprises, helping you make the most of your stay.
Spanish citizens need a visa to enter Egypt. You can obtain it upon arrival (Visa on Arrival) at major airports like Cairo or Luxor, or process it beforehand electronically (e-Visa). The visa on arrival costs about 25 USD and is valid for 30 days. Make sure your passport is valid for at least six months from the date of entry. Carrying separate copies of your passport and visa is a good safety practice.
For long distances, internal flights are fast and efficient, especially between Cairo, Luxor, and Aswan. Overnight trains are a more economical option for traveling between Cairo and the south, although they can be slow. Within cities, use taxis or ride-sharing services like Uber or Careem, which offer fixed fares and avoid haggling. In Cairo, the metro is useful for avoiding traffic. To visit monuments, consider hiring a private driver for the day, which will give you flexibility. Always agree on the taxi price before getting in, unless they use a meter.
Egypt offers a wide range of accommodations, from luxury hotels in Cairo and along the Nile, to budget hostels and guesthouses. In major tourist cities, you will find international hotel chains. For a local experience, look for boutique hotels or 'dahabiyas' (traditional sailing boats) for a Nile cruise. In Cairo, the Zamalek or Maadi areas are popular for being quieter and central. Always read recent reviews before booking. Many hotels offer breakfast included, which is useful for starting your sightseeing day. Consider staying near a metro station if you plan to use public transport frequently.
Egypt is generally safe for tourists, but caution is key. Be mindful of your belongings in crowded markets like Khan el Khalili. Common scams include unofficial 'guides' who approach you at archaeological sites or taxi drivers who claim your hotel is closed. Be firm and polite when declining unwanted offers. Regarding health, always drink bottled water and avoid ice. It is advisable to carry basic medications for stomach problems. Take out comprehensive travel insurance before leaving Spain. Never accept food or drink from strangers and avoid walking alone in poorly lit areas at night. Tourist police are present at all important sites.
Egypt is a majority Muslim country, so modesty in dress is valued, especially when visiting mosques or rural areas. Women should cover their shoulders and knees. In tourist areas, dress is more relaxed. It is customary to haggle in markets, but do so with a smile and respect. Tipping (baksheesh) is essential for almost any service, from carrying bags to using public restrooms. Use your right hand for eating and giving things, as the left is considered impure. Learning some basic phrases in Arabic, such as 'shukran' (thank you), will be greatly appreciated by locals. Respect prayer times and avoid eating, drinking, or smoking in public during Ramadan.
Egyptian food is flavorful and based on legumes, vegetables, and meats. Try *koshari* (rice, lentils, pasta, and tomato sauce), the national dish. Other must-try items are *ful medames* (cooked fava beans) for breakfast and *ta'ameya* (Egyptian falafel). Grilled lamb and chicken are excellent. Avoid street food that is not freshly made and very hot. In Cairo and Alexandria, look for local restaurants that are crowded; it is a good sign of quality. Drink hibiscus tea (*karkade*) and avoid alcohol outside hotels and tourist restaurants. For an authentic experience, look for a restaurant that serves *mahshi* (stuffed vegetables).
A typical 7 to 10-day trip combines Cairo (Pyramids, Egyptian Museum) with a Nile cruise between Luxor and Aswan. Reserve at least three full days for Cairo. Consider adding a couple of days on the Red Sea coast (Sharm el Sheikh or Hurghada) if you enjoy diving. To avoid crowds and extreme heat, start visits to archaeological sites very early in the morning. Don't try to see too much in one day; the pace in Egypt can be exhausting. TICKETS.COM.ES Tip: For an unforgettable photo, visit the Abu Simbel Temple at sunrise. It's a long trip from Aswan, but the golden light on the statues is magical, and you'll have fewer people around.
